MATT: So we are a bit behing on the blog...Kel is still trying to finish writing about Oz and I am trying to get a bit of NZ done. I am about two weeks out of date...so bear with me if some of the details seem a bit fuzzy.
We were put up (very kindly) by Sarah and Tim (Sarah and ex E&Y collegue of Kel) at there very nice house in a suburb of Auckland. Immediately we got a good feeling about NZ....very chilled, nice people, good climate - not as hot as Oz but sunny all the same - plus considerably less things that will bite you, poison you, sting you or eat you than Oz....seems generally like a much more sensible place.
We buzzed through a couple of days in Auckland, the main event being climbing a volcanic island (Rangitoto) in the harbour which gives an amazing view of the city and the bay islands, eating dinner with Sarah and Tim and then making a new friend...namely our camper van which will be our home for the next six weeks. I christened it Casper (cause it is white and friendly and a spirit model) - it is a converted VW panel van - and perfect for our needs. It transported us quickly out of Auckland and North to the Bay of Islands for our first night as gypsies....
